WIND DIRECTION SENSOR WDR SKU: WDR Doc No: WDR-DS-EN-10 Introduction The wind direction sensor is used to measure the direction value of the wind and convert it into an electrical signal, which can be directly transmitted to the recording device for processing. The sensor housing is made of polycarbonate environmental protection material, with very small dimensional tolerances and high surface accuracy. The wind direction sensor adopts low inertia wind vane and precision potentiometer, with high sensitivity and high precision. Weather resistant; High durability; High data transmission efficiency and reliable. Typical applications Weather Station; Ship navigation; Aviation; Weather buoys; Wind turbines. Specification Measure range 0-360 degree Start wind 0.5 m/s Resolution 0.1 degree Accuracy +/- 1 degree Maximum turning radius 200mm Output 0..5VDC or RS485 ModbusRTU Power supply 12..24VDC Power consumption ≤0.3W Working temperature -20~60℃ Working humidity ≤100%RH Cable specifications 2m 3-wire system (analog signal) Ordering Code Item code Descriptions WDR-01-ANALOG WIND DIRECTION SENSOR, 0-360 DEGREE, CARBON FIBER, 0-5VDC OUTPUT, 12-24VDC, WITH CABLE AND CONNECTOR MBRTU-WDR-01 WIND DIRECTION SENSOR, 0-360 DEGREE, CARBON FIBER, MODBUSRTU RS485 OUTPUT, 12-24VDC, IP65 Link for full datasheet: Link for manual: Daviteq Technologies Inc  www.daviteq.com   |     info@daviteq.com
